  • Cloudy, With a Chance of Powers

    As Asian economies grow, increased pollution affecting world’s weather Scientists say smog from Asia is drifting east, seeding storm clouds, and intensifying weather in the Pacific. On a typical spring or summer day, they say, nearly a third of the air high above the U.S. West Coast comes from Asia. And according to a report […]
